What is happening when the Asparagus Plumosus blooms?
Asparagus Plumosus is a common ornamental leaf plant, but if well cared for and growing vigorously, it can bloom, which is a normal phenomenon and there is no need to worry. Its blooming period is usually between September and October. The flowers are white with short peduncles. The flowers are not very ornamental, so they can be cut off when they bloom to reduce nutrient consumption and promote the plant to recover growth as soon as possible. To make it bloom, a warm, humid, and nutrient-rich environment is required.
